How a Salary After Tax Calculator Works


A salary after tax calculator usually requires the following details:
• Gross monthly or annual salary
• Tax deductions applicable under your income bracket
• Allowances such as HRA, transport, or medical benefits
• Contributions to EPF, insurance, or other statutory schemes

Once these details are submitted, the calculator instantly displays your after-tax pay—the actual pay you receive after all deductions. How Much Tax Is Deducted from Your Salary?


The question “tax rate on salary?” depends on your earning range and deductions. Common deductions include:
• Income tax based on government-defined slabs
• EPF contribution (approx. 12% of basic)
• Professional tax depending on state
• Insurance and additional statutory cuts

Using a tax on salary calculator makes these figures easy to estimate and shows your total tax burden.

What Affects Your Net Income


• Income tax bracket and surcharge
• Allowances such as HRA, DA, and travel
• Exemptions under tax laws
• Retirement contributions like EPF or NPS
• Performance-linked components

Understanding these factors allows you to use the take-home salary tool more accurately for personal budgeting.
